【赠书第21期】游戏力:竞技游戏设计实战教程

文章目录

前言

1 竞技游戏设计的核心要素

1.1 游戏机制

1.2 角色与技能

1.3 地图与环境

2 竞技游戏设计的策略与方法

2.1 以玩家为中心

2.2 不断迭代与优化

2.3 营造竞技氛围与社区文化

3 实战案例分析

4 结语

5 推荐图书

6 粉丝福利


前言

在数字化时代的浪潮中,竞技游戏已经成为了一种独特的文化现象。它融合了技术、策略、团队协作与竞技精神,吸引了全球亿万玩家的热情参与。作为游戏设计师,如何在这个竞争激烈的市场中脱颖而出,设计出引人入胜、富有挑战性的竞技游戏,成为了摆在我们面前的重要课题。本文将围绕竞技游戏设计的实战教程展开,探讨游戏设计的核心要素与策略,以期为广大游戏设计师提供有益的参考与启示。


1 竞技游戏设计的核心要素

1.1 游戏机制

游戏机制是竞技游戏设计的基石,它决定了玩家如何与游戏进行互动,以及游戏的玩法和规则。在竞技游戏设计中,我们需要关注机制的平衡性、深度和趣味性。平衡性是指游戏中各个元素之间的相互制约,避免出现过于强势或弱势的角色或技能;深度则是指游戏机制所包含的策略性和变化性,让玩家在游戏中能够不断探索和尝试新的玩法;趣味性则是游戏机制能够激发玩家兴趣,让他们愿意投入时间和精力去玩耍。

1.2 角色与技能

在竞技游戏中,角色与技能是玩家进行游戏的主要载体。我们需要设计各具特色的角色和技能,让玩家在游戏中能够找到自己喜欢的定位与风格。同时,我们还需要关注角色与技能之间的平衡性,避免出现过于强势或弱势的组合,以确保游戏的公平性和竞技性。

1.3 地图与环境

地图与环境是竞技游戏中的重要元素,它们为玩家提供了游戏的空间和背景。在设计地图与环境时,我们需要考虑地图的布局、资源分布、障碍物等因素,以创造出多样化的游戏场景和战术选择。同时,我们还需要关注地图与游戏机制的契合度,确保地图能够充分展现游戏的玩法和特点。

2 竞技游戏设计的策略与方法

2.1 以玩家为中心

在竞技游戏设计中,我们需要始终以玩家为中心,关注他们的需求和体验。通过收集和分析玩家的反馈和数据,我们可以了解他们的喜好和痛点,从而针对性地优化游戏设计。同时,我们还需要关注玩家的成长与变化,设计具有挑战性和成长性的游戏内容,让玩家在游戏中能够不断提升自己的技能和水平。

2.2 不断迭代与优化

竞技游戏设计是一个持续迭代与优化的过程。我们需要根据玩家的反馈和市场变化,不断调整游戏机制、角色、地图等元素,以保持游戏的活力和吸引力。同时,我们还需要关注新技术和新趋势的发展,将其应用于游戏设计中,以提升游戏的品质和竞争力。

2.3 营造竞技氛围与社区文化

竞技游戏的核心魅力在于其竞技性和社交性。我们需要通过游戏设计来营造紧张刺激的竞技氛围,激发玩家的竞技欲望和团队精神。同时,我们还需要关注社区文化的建设,鼓励玩家之间的交流与互动,形成积极健康的社区氛围。

3 实战案例分析

为了更具体地说明竞技游戏设计的实战应用,我们可以选取一些成功的竞技游戏案例进行分析。例如,《英雄联盟》、《王者荣耀》等游戏,它们在游戏机制、角色与技能、地图与环境等方面都有着出色的设计,吸引了大量玩家的喜爱和追捧。通过分析这些案例,我们可以学习到如何在竞技游戏设计中平衡各种元素,创造出具有吸引力的游戏世界。

4 结语

竞技游戏设计是一项充满挑战与机遇的工作。作为游戏设计师,我们需要不断学习和探索新的设计理念和方法,以应对市场的变化和玩家的需求。通过关注游戏机制、角色与技能、地图与环境等核心要素,以及采用以玩家为中心、不断迭代与优化、营造竞技氛围与社区文化等策略与方法,我们可以设计出更加引人入胜、富有挑战性的竞技游戏,为玩家带来更加丰富的游戏体验。

5 推荐图书

《游戏力:竞技游戏设计实战教程》

深度剖析竞技游戏的构造核心、技能设计、地图设计、游戏系统和交互设计,解析游戏设计的深层理念与思想,让你一本书读懂游戏设计本质。 

编辑推荐

1. 从选题立意出发,详细讲解“好游戏”的设计前提:选题决定了游戏的主题和基调,进而影响游戏的整体设计和玩家体验,一个好的选题,可以让游戏赢在起跑线。

2. 讲解游戏核心机制设计,是游戏“好玩”的关键:游戏的核心机制是游戏的灵魂,直接决定玩家的留存率,通过合理设计核心机制,游戏能够吸引更多的玩家,提高游戏的市场占有率与盈利能力。

3. 分门别类分解游戏设计过程:详细介绍游戏的技能设计、地图设计、含社交系统、匹配机制、排行榜段位、付费与成就系统等,让游戏的每一个细节都充满吸引力。

内容简介

本书写给想成为游戏设计师的你。如果你也热爱玩游戏,甚至想要成为一名竞技游戏设计师,为游戏行业贡献一份自己的力量,在游戏历史上留下浓墨重彩的一笔,那就翻开这本书看看吧。

本书共 6 章,另加《英雄联盟》角色技能拆解附录。其中第 1 章讲解制作游戏的选题立意;第 2 章讲解游戏核心机制设计;第 3 章讲解技能设计法则;第 4 章讲解地图设计原理;第 5 章分析如何设计游戏的系统,包含社交系统、匹配机制、排行榜段位、付费与成就系统等;第 6 章阐述游戏交互设计相关知识。本书适合游戏从业人员、各大院校的游戏专业学生、游戏开发爱好者阅读和使用。

6 粉丝福利

现在点赞 + 收藏 + 任意评论

评论区将随机抽取至多三名小伙伴免费赠书一本;

截止日期:2024年3月30日

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/764956.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

Rust之构建命令行程序(五):环境变量

开发环境 Windows 11Rust 1.77.0 VS Code 1.87.2 项目工程 这次创建了新的工程minigrep. 使用环境变量 我们将通过添加一个额外的功能来改进minigrep:一个不区分大小写的搜索选项,用户可以通过环境变量打开该选项。我们可以将此功能设置为命令行选项,…

uniapp(vue3) H5页面连接打印机并打印

一、找到对应厂商打印机的驱动并在windows上面安装。查看是否安装完成可以在:控制面板->查看设备和打印机,找到对应打印机驱动是否安装完成 二、打印机USB连接电脑 三、运行代码调用浏览器打印,主要使用的是window.print()功能。下面使用…

前端学习笔记 | Node.js

一、Node.js入门 1、什么是Node.js 定义:是跨平台JS运行环境(可以独立执行JS的环境)作用: 编写数据接口,提供网页资源功能等等前端工程化:为后续学Vue和React等框架做铺垫 2、Node.js为何能执行JS&#xff…

python分类信息服务平台移动端的设计与实现flask-django-php-nodejs

分类信息服务平台设计的目的是为用户提供活动信息、活动记录等方面的平台。 与PC端应用程序相比,分类信息服务平台的设计主要面向于移动端,旨在为管理员和用户、商铺提供一个分类信息服务平台。用户可以通过Android及时查看活动信息等。 分类信息服务平台…

IDEA调优-四大基础配置-编码纵享丝滑

文章目录 1.JVM虚拟机选项配置2.多线程编译速度3.构建共享堆内存大小4.关闭不必要的插件 1.JVM虚拟机选项配置 -Xms128m -Xmx8192m -XX:ReservedCodeCacheSize1024m -XX:UseG1GC -XX:SoftRefLRUPolicyMSPerMB50 -XX:CICompilerCount2 -XX:HeapDumpOnOutOfMemoryError -XX:-Omi…

pytest之fixture结合conftest.py文件使用+断言实战

pytest之fixture结合conftest.py文件使用 conftest.py--存放固件固件的优先级pytest执行流程pytest之断言实战pytest结合allure-pytest插件生成美观的报告 conftest.py–存放固件 在一个项目的测试中,大多数情况下会有多个类、模块、或者包要使用相同的测试夹具。这…

kafka2.x版本配置SSL进行加密和身份验证

背景:找了一圈资料,都是东讲讲西讲讲,最后我还没搞好,最终决定参考官网说明。 官网指导手册地址:Apache Kafka 需要预备的知识,keytool和openssl 关于keytool的参考:keytool的使用-CSDN博客 …

Pytest测试框架+allure+jenkins自动化持续集成

Pytest是python的一种单元测试框架,可通过pytest 目录路径来运行测试用例 可以通过断言assert来测试是否通过 1.pytest测试用例命名规范 需严格遵循此规范,不然使用 pytest 目录 来运行会找不到该条测试用例。 可通过这样定义main函数&#xf…

Redis入门到实战-第二弹

Redis入门到实战 Redis安装官网地址Redis概述Redis-server安装Redis-stack-server使用(可选)Redisinsight安装(可选)更新计划 Redis安装 官网地址 声明: 由于操作系统, 版本更新等原因, 文章所列内容不一定100%复现, 还要以官方信息为准 https://redis.io/Redis概述 Redis是…

LabVIEW焓差试验室流量计现场自动校准系统

LabVIEW焓差试验室流量计现场自动校准系统 在现代工业和科研领域,流量计的准确性对于保证生产过程的质量和效率非常重要。开发了一种基于LabVIEW的焓差试验室流量计现场自动校准系统,通过提高流量计校准的准确性和效率。 在空调器空气焓值法能效测量装…

java网络原理(二)------TCP确认应答和超时重传

一Tcp协议 TCP,即Transmission Control Protocol,传输控制协议。人如其名,要对数据的传输进行一个详细的控制。 二.TCP协议段格式 知道了端口号才能进一步确认这个数据报交给了哪一个程序。16为端口号是2字节,范围是0到65535.如…

redis功能点

一、redis简介 概述 Redis 是速度非常快的非关系型(NoSQL)内存键值数据库,可以存储键和五种不同类型的值之间的映射。键的类型只能为字符串,值支持五种数据类型:字符串、列表、集合、散列表、有序集合。 Redis 支持很…

windows端给python重命名,快速将默认的python修改为 python3

问题点 在windows上,我们实际已经安装了python,但默认的是 python, 可能有的程序执行需要用到 python3,下面的方法可以快速将默认的python修改为 python3 解决方法 此方法需要保证windows上已经安装了python 1:首先找到系统的…

LED显示屏视频播放器的8大功能

随着中国LED显示屏企业的规模发展和产品技术的不断创新,LED显示屏在各个领域中的应用得到了广泛推广。然而,LED显示屏的出色表现离不开LED视频播放器这一关键设备的支持。下面将介绍LED视频播放器的8大功能,以及它们如何提升LED显示屏的显像效…

FPGA - AXI4_Lite(实现用户端与axi4_lite之间的交互逻辑)

在之前的博客中对AXI4总线进行了介绍(FPGA-AXI4接口协议概述),在这篇博客中,实现用户端与axi4_lite之间的交互逻辑。 一, AXI4 1.1 AXI4 介绍 对AXI4总线简单介绍(具体可见FPGA-AXI4接口协议概述&#…

(done) 机器学习中的方差 variance 和 偏差 bias 怎么理解?

来源:https://blog.csdn.net/weixin_41479678/article/details/116230631 情况1属于:低 bias,高 variance (和 human performance 相近,但和 验证集dev set 相远) 通常意味着模型训练轮数太多 情况2属于:高 bias&#…

微服务高级篇(三):分布式缓存+Redis集群

文章目录 一、单点Redis的问题及解决方案二、Redis持久化2.1 单机安装Redis2.2 RDB持久化2.3 AOF持久化2.4 RDB和AOF对比 三、Redis主从3.1 搭建Redis主从架构3.1.1 集群结构3.1.2 准备实例和配置3.1.3 启动3.1.4 开启主从关系3.1.5 测试 3.2 数据同步3.2.1 全量同步【建立连接…

【Web应用技术基础】HTML(5)——案例1:展示简历信息

样式&#xff1a; 代码&#xff1a; <!DOCTYPE html> <html lang"en"> <head><meta charset"UTF-8"><meta name"viewport" content"widthdevice-width, initial-scale1.0"><title>展示简历信息…

真机笔记(1)第一阶段知识讲解

目录 第一阶段讲解&#xff1a; 1.1 机房 1.2 分类&#xff1a; 1.3 机房建设标准 1.3.1 安全性: 1.3.2 供电&#xff1a; 1.3.3 空气调节&#xff1a;&#xff08;恒温恒湿&#xff09; 1.3.4 电磁防护&#xff1a; 2.1 机柜 2.2 分类 2.3 机柜的高度单位 3.1 设备…

【教程】PLSQL查看表属性乱码解决方法

一、前言 PL/SQL是Oracle数据库的编程语言&#xff0c;用于编写存储过程、触发器、函数等。 今天用plsql想查看表的属性&#xff0c;看看各个字段的注释&#xff0c;可是打开一看&#xff0c;居然是乱码的&#xff0c;如下面这样 如果在使用PL/SQL查看表属性时出现乱码&…